Look At Me

Look at Me He is just one of the many, a lonely man Striving to become whatever he can All I am is not what you choose to see If you seek a friend then look at me The old man sits on the corner all alone A next meal from where it comes unknown You look away, disgusted by what you see All he asks, don’t just walk by, look at me The drug addict lost within a world, forsaken Coursing through his blood all the drugs taken Don’t take pity on me, go, just leave me be Who are you to judge me, don’t look at me Remember, be grateful when your life is good And try to help those as much as you should Because life doesn’t come with any guarantee You maybe the one that asks, just look at me
